Households who own or rent their homes can use solar energy without having to buy or install special equipment. Community solar projects, sometimes called "solar farms," are a collection of solar panels that.
This is because solar systems generally depend on the electrical grid to produce power—and, for safety reasons, they're designed to switch off if the grid power cuts out.
